Frankfurt (officieel: Frankfurt am Main (Duits: [ˈfʁaŋkfʊʁt ʔam ˈmaɪn]; Hessian: Frangford am Maa; letterlijk "Frank Ford op de Main")) is een metropool en de grootste stad van de Duitse deelstaat Hessen, en haar Met 746.878 (2017) inwoners is het de op vier na grootste stad van Duitsland. Aan de rivier de Main (een zijrivier van de Rijn) vormt het een continue agglomeratie met de naburige stad Offenbach am Main en heeft het stedelijke gebied 2,3 miljoen inwoners. Lyon of Lyon (VK:, VS:, Frans: [ljɔ̃]; Arpitan: Liyon, uitgesproken als [ʎjɔ̃]; Italiaans: Lione, uitgesproken als [liˈone]) is de op twee na grootste stad en het op één na grootste stedelijke gebied van Frankrijk. Het is gelegen in het oost-centrale deel van het land aan de samenvloeiing van de rivieren Rhône en Saône, ongeveer 470 km (292 mijl) ten zuiden van Parijs, 320 km (199 mijl) ten noorden van Marseille en 56 km (35 mijl) ten noordoosten van Saint -Étienne.
